Transaction 323ebf261fd2931d64d81783bfb2988680e6e0e0ad895ae1ad17f3e36de29022
1 Input
1 Output
-
323ebf261fd2931d64d81783bfb2988680e6e0e0ad895ae1ad17f3e36de29022:0
- value
- 981813769
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 8f6fa1403e14fbeb67bcbb4e02d5ca6ae37c0d5f OP_EQUALVERIFY OP_CHECKSIG
- address
- 1E5RMcWaMPDaMDQnch2tFuAuxdBaV9TJQL